Debenhams

Debenhams is among the oldest department store chains in the United Kingdom, founded in 1778 as a luxury drapers shop located in London's Wigmore Street. The company has grown to become an important player in the British retail industry, with over 200 large stores worldwide and exclusive partnerships with top designers Jasper Conran and Julien Macdonald.

Burton Group took over the retailer in 1985. The group later joined with Arcadia, a retail empire headed by Sir Philip Green. Within a couple of years, the company's profits fell and debts grew as the retailer was locked in leases that cost a lot of money.

In 2021, Boohoo acquired the brand and closed its physical stores. Two years later the closing, only 4 of 10 former Debenhams stores across GB have been reoccupied, and the rest remain empty. Some of the former stores were transformed into mixed-use developments, while others were reused by different brands, such as Next Beauty Hall and The Range. Wales has the highest percentage of empty ex Debenhams sites. Northern Ireland and the Midlands are next.

House of Fraser

House of Fraser, a chain of department stores that was founded in Glasgow in 1849, is situated in Scotland. It was initially a drapery shop, and later added a range of items including shoes and luggage. Later, the company began to expand, acquiring rival stores like Bentalls. The company also expanded its own clothing line, introducing the Linea label.

Despite their expansion, House of Fraser continued to struggle with the changing shopping habits of UK consumers. The increase in online retailers and the decline of traditional high-street stores led to their financial woes. The company also had a lot of inventory and a large debt burden.

In 2003, Tom Hunter made a hostile offer to purchase the company with the possibility of combining it with Allders, another department store where the latter held shares. At the time, many House of Fraser shops in Scotland were shut down or transferred to other stores. The company was eventually bought by Mike Ashley, who planned to rename it Frasers and create new stores. The acquisition has led to some supplier relationships being damaged, causing uncertainty for the company.
